.TOAST File Extension

A .TOAST file is a Toast Disc Image, created by Roxio.

Open with Roxio Toast 20. Available for Mac.

What is a .TOAST file?

A .TOAST file is a type of file that acts like a digital copy of the contents of a CD or DVD. It's made using a program called Roxio Toast, which is a software used on Mac OS X computers for creating CDs and DVDs. This file includes all the data that would be on the actual disc, but it's stored in a single file on your computer. The .TOAST file is similar to another common type of disc image file known as an .ISO file, but it has some extra information that is specific to the Roxio Toast program. This means that while it works a lot like an .ISO file, it has some special features or formatting that are unique to Toast.

To open a .TOAST file, you would typically use the Roxio Toast program, since it's specifically designed to work with these files. Roxio Toast 20 is the latest version that can open and manage .TOAST files. Another program by the same company, called Roxio Popcorn, can also open .TOAST files. Popcorn is mainly used for copying DVDs and converting video files, but it can work with .TOAST files too. These programs allow you to view the contents of the .TOAST file, extract data from it, or even burn it onto a physical CD or DVD if you want to create a physical disc from the digital image.
